Everyone who knows Sloan knows that he LOVES music. Most of you know that he mostly enjoys kids/family music, and that he listens to an XM radio station called Kids Place Live. They play great fun music, and the radio is on from the moment Sloan wakes up until he goes to bed, every single day. (You may not know that Sloan's computer can also function as a remote control. Sloan is able to browse around for different music on his radio, and is a big ol' channel flipper.:-) He always goes back to Kids Place Live though.) One of the artists that Sloan hears on the radio 1-2 times an hour in the typical rotation is a musician named Billy Jonas. ALL of Billy's songs are favorites and are very well loved. Sloan has heard Billy's songs, interviews and live performances on the radio, his cds, and even on our local NPR show, The State of Things. (To get an idea of Billy's wonderful personality, soothing voice, and excellent music, we highly recommend this interview!) Billy has gotten us through many traffic jams in Washington and Atlanta as we have travelled here and there by listening to his concerts. So last spring, we were browsing around the websites of Sloan's favorite musicians to see if any of them would be playing around here. Voila! Billy Jonas was coming to Raleigh in November! We wrote it down.
Last night was finally the big night!



The venue for the show was a very unique and intimate setting at Little Lake Hill House, owned by Bett and Bill Page. We began contact with them in early October to make sure we were able to go, and Bett was so very helpful in answering all the questions we had. This was a house concert in the Page's home, where they host a whole series of concerts, and it was the best live music experience we could have. It was a smaller crowd, we didn't have to worry about the speakers being too loud, and best of all, Sloan got to meet and talk to Billy Jonas!!! We met him pretty soon after entering the house, and Sloan introduced himself and told Billy about how much he loves his music. During the show, Billy invited Sloan to play back-up bells during one of his songs, and one of the greatest things about the live show- Billy invites everyone to sing along with him, and that is one of Sloan's absolute favorite things. After the show, we had a chance to talk to Billy some more, and as you can tell from the pictures, Sloan was euphoric. Billy seemed very appreciative of Sloan's love of his music as well.


Other highlights of the night are: Our friend Sasha was able to join us. We picked him up and we all went out to dinner at the Flying Biscuit in Cameron Village before the show. Sloan got yet another very cool t-shirt with the title of this post on the front, taken from one of Billy's songs. And we also got to meet Ashley Farmer, Billy's back-up singer with the very beautiful voice.




What a night!! We can't wait to catch Billy in a live show again!
